- [ ] Step 7: Archive cold storage buckets (Glacierline tier). Confirm both ceremony witnesses are present, verify bucket manifests match the Oxbow ledger, then seal the archive key shares. Plugin authors may observe but not handle shares. Once sealed, the archive index itself is encrypted and can only be reopened with the passphrase below.

vault phrase of badup-hahig = tamael-aldael-kelmir-istael-fenok-istwyn-tamius-jorath-oliion

# DeployCrier posts deploy status into the team chat: start, progress, and
# final outcome per environment. To avoid spamming channels during rollbacks,
# messages are coalesced within a short window and progress updates are
# rate-limited. Failures always post immediately regardless of throttling.
# Release managers: adjust cadence here, not in the bot service itself.
# The tuning constants are defined below.

tuning table, yajog-yahof:
BUDGETS = {
    "lamvan": 303,
    "wenox": 460,
    "fenvan": 525,
}

Reviewer note: offline mode in the Fernpath survey app stashes unsynced plots in an encrypted local store, keyed off the surveyor's account. If someone gets locked out in the field, recovery has to happen on-device — there's no server reset, by design. Please sanity-check that flow in this PR. To test it yourself, the staging account unlocks with the passphrase directly below.

unlock words, hahip-baduf: holwyn-istath-julvan